102416.3(a)(6) · 102416.3 (a)(6) Alteration to Existing Building or Grounds. Prior to any alteration, the licensee shall notify the Department of any change from an area of the home previously identified as “off limits” to an area where care and supervision will be provided to children in care.
LPA spoke with the Licensee regarding the fire clearance, which does not permit the use of the second floor for child care. LPA explained that the area is off-limits and cannot be used for daycare-related activities to include nap. The Licensee agreed to submit a written statement confirming that the second floor will not be used for sleeping or any part of the daycare operation. Based on record review the licensee did not comply with the section cited above, where the Fire Clearance granted by the Oceanside Fire Department on 09/20/2024 states the daycare including sleeping areas are to be on first floor only, and the LIC 999 Sketch indicate the second floor is off limits and not to be used by children in care, however the second floor was used for some napping children during daycare hours, po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

102417(g)(3) · (g) The home shall be free from defects or conditions which might endanger a child. Safety precautions shall include but not limited to: (3) Where children are less than five years old are in care, stairs shall be fenced or barricaded. The requirment was not met as evidenced by Licensee will submit a written statement to CCL by POC date, confirming understanding of the regulation and requirment.
Based on observation and interview,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in 1 out of 1 counts, where the stairs to the second floor were not properly barricaded/made inaccessible during daycare hours, which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care
